Comparing Wellness Getaway Options
| Category | Example Focus | Typical Price Range | Ideal For | Key Benefits | Considerations |
|---|
| Destination Spa Resort | Comprehensive wellness with medical consultation | $400-$800 per night | Those seeking a full-service, luxury reset | On-site experts, gourmet healthy dining, extensive facilities | Higher cost, often requires longer stay for full benefit |
| Nature-Based Retreat | Forest bathing, hiking, outdoor yoga | $200-$400 per night | Nature lovers, digital detox seekers | Deep connection with environment, often more affordable | May have fewer luxury amenities, program can be weather-dependent |
| Urban Wellness Hotel | Fitness classes, spa access, healthy room service | $250-$500 per night | City travelers combining business with self-care | Convenience, high-end facilities, located in city centers | Can be less immersive, city noise may impact relaxation |
| Specialized Workshop Retreat | Yoga teacher training, meditation intensives | $1500-$3000+ for 5-7 days | Individuals focusing on a specific skill or practice | Deep, transformative learning, community building | Requires time commitment, intensity may not suit beginners |
| Affordable Wellness Weekend | Local retreat centers, state park lodges | $100-$250 per night | Budget-conscious travelers, first-time retreat-goers | Accessible price point, often closer to home | Services may be more basic, programming less extensive |

Different regions offer unique healing environments. In the Southwest, the dry heat and vast landscapes are central to the experience. Many retreats in Arizona or New Mexico incorporate Native American-inspired practices and use the desert's stillness for meditation. Conversely, a wellness getaway in New England might focus on the crisp air of the mountains, farm-to-table nutrition workshops, and mindfulness walks through autumn foliage. Researching these regional specialties can lead you to a more authentic and effective experience.
When considering cost, look beyond the nightly rate. Many centers offer all-inclusive packages that cover meals, activities, and sometimes even consultations, which can provide better overall value. Some retreats offer shared accommodations or off-peak discounts, making a wellness retreat for stress relief more accessible. It's also worth checking if your health savings account (HSA) or flexible spending account (FSA) can be used for certain programs with a doctor's recommendation, as some medically-oriented retreats may qualify.
Taking the Next Steps
Start by defining your primary goal. Is it to unplug, to kickstart a fitness routine, to learn meditation, or to simply rest? Once you have a clear intention, filter your search geographically. Use terms like "wellness retreats in Colorado for beginners" or "affordable yoga retreat Florida coast" to find relevant options. Read recent reviews attentively, paying close attention to comments about the staff's expertise, the actual daily schedule, and the food quality.
Reach out directly to the retreat centers with your questions. A reputable center will be transparent about what a typical day looks like, the group size, and the instructors' credentials. Ask about their approach—is it more clinical, spiritual, or fitness-oriented? This conversation can tell you a lot about whether their philosophy matches your needs.
